Designing for Different Devices – Ensuring Consistency Across Platforms

Design for various devices requires a keen understanding of user preferences and behaviors, ensuring that your digital experience remains seamless. By focusing on responsive layouts, adaptable visuals, and fluid navigation, you can create a cohesive brand identity that resonates with users across all platforms. This approach not only enhances usability but also strengthens engagement, making it important to prioritize consistency in your design strategy. Explore how you can successfully align your design efforts to meet the diverse needs of your audience, regardless of the device they choose.

Understanding Device Diversity

Device diversity significantly impacts how users experience digital content. Each platform presents unique characteristics and user expectations that must be considered in design. From screen size and resolution to processing power, these factors influence usability and functionality. Thus, understanding the nuances of various devices allows you to create more tailored and efficient designs that enhance user engagement across all platforms.

Mobile Devices

Mobile devices, including smartphones and tablets, dominate the digital landscape, with over 50% of web traffic originating from them. Designs must be adaptable to smaller screens, focusing on touch optimization and simplified navigation. Users frequently seek quick, easily digestible content, emphasizing the importance of concise messaging and visual appeal.

Desktop and Laptop Computers

Desktop and laptop computers cater to a different user experience, often prioritizing functionality and detailed content presentation. Users typically engage with a larger display, allowing for more intricate layouts and interactions. This setting benefits from utilizing higher resolution images, accommodating multiple windows, and integrating comprehensive tools suitable for multitasking. Effective design here should balance aesthetics and usability, ensuring that users can easily navigate complex information without feeling overwhelmed.

Desktop and laptop interfaces can incorporate advanced features such as hover effects, dropdown menus, and extensive navigation options that wouldn’t work well on mobile devices. Moreover, understanding that users often perform tasks ranging from detailed research to professional work helps in crafting interfaces that support productivity. With larger screens available, you can also enhance graphic elements and integrate more content seamlessly, ensuring that the user’s focus remains on the task at hand, without sacrificing visual appeal or functionality.

Key Principles of Responsive Design

Responsive design centers around creating an optimal viewing experience across a range of devices. This approach emphasizes adaptability, allowing your content to fluidly adjust to different screen sizes and orientations. Implementing responsive techniques not only improves accessibility and usability but also enhances SEO performance. By prioritizing user-centric design, you create a more engaging and effective interaction with your audience, regardless of the device they choose.

Fluid Grids

Fluid grids utilize relative units like percentages instead of fixed pixels, allowing your layout to scale seamlessly across various screen sizes. This method promotes a flexible arrangement where elements resize proportionately, ensuring a cohesive look regardless of whether the user is on a smartphone, tablet, or desktop. By adopting fluid grids, you can achieve a more harmonious and adaptable design that responds to your audience’s context.

Flexible Images

Flexible images adapt within their containing elements while maintaining their aspect ratios. This adjustment prevents images from breaking layouts on smaller screens. Utilizing CSS properties like max-width: 100% allows images to resize fluidly, effectively ensuring they fit within different containers without losing clarity or distortion. This practice is vital for creating a polished visual experience across your platforms.

Implementing flexible images goes beyond just responsive sizing; it involves optimizing them for different devices and loading speeds. Techniques such as using modern formats like WebP or leveraging responsive image attributes (srcset) enable you to deliver the best quality and performance. Properly optimized images can enhance load times significantly—important since studies reveal that a mere one-second delay can result in a 7% loss in conversions. By incorporating various image resolutions tailored to device specifications, you ensure that your content is engaging and visually appealing for every user.

User Experience Across Platforms

Your design should prioritize user experience across various devices, ensuring that functionality and aesthetics are seamlessly integrated. Each platform—desktop, tablet, or smartphone—demands unique interactions and display adjustments. Recognizing these factors enables you to tailor experiences that resonate with users, making your digital presence more effective and engaging.

Consistency in Navigation

You should maintain a consistent navigation structure across all devices to facilitate user familiarity and ease of use. Implementing similar iconography, menu order, and interactive elements enhances the user experience and ensures that users can effortlessly transition between platforms. This consistency reduces the learning curve and helps retain user engagement.

Tailoring Content for Each Device

Adapting your content to fit the specific capabilities and contexts of each device is important for optimal engagement. For example, mobile users often prefer concise information, while desktop audiences might appreciate detailed articles. Analyzing your audience’s behavior can guide you in adjusting text length, image sizes, and overall layout to fit each platform’s strengths, ensuring content is both accessible and engaging.

Tailoring content effectively involves not just resizing text or images but also rethinking the narrative flow. On mobile devices, you might use bullet points for quick readability, while on desktops, longer form content could be appropriate. Implementing tools like responsive typography ensures that your text displays elegantly across resolutions. Additionally, implementing interactive features such as quizzes or videos can engage mobile users in a way that’s less effective on larger screens. By respecting each device’s unique characteristics, you enhance user engagement and satisfaction.

Tools and Frameworks for Consistency

Leveraging the right tools and frameworks can greatly enhance your ability to maintain consistency across various devices. Selecting the appropriate technology stack ensures that your design not only performs well but also provides a seamless user experience. From CSS frameworks to responsive design tools, every element plays a role in achieving a unified look and feel across platforms.

CSS Frameworks

CSS frameworks streamline your design process by offering pre-built components and grid systems that adapt to different devices. Frameworks like Bootstrap or Foundation allow you to create responsive layouts quickly, reducing the time needed for adjustments while ensuring your design remains visually consistent across platforms.

Responsive Design Tools

Responsive design tools such as Adobe XD, Figma, and Sketch enable you to create and test designs that adapt fluidly to various screen sizes. These tools often include features like auto-layout and design libraries, which help maintain consistency in spacing, typography, and component usage across different devices.

Figma stands out as an excellent choice due to its collaborative features, allowing your team to work simultaneously on design elements. The platform supports prototyping and real-time feedback, making it easier to iterate and ensure that changes are reflected consistently across devices. Tools like these also often integrate with development environments, ensuring your design intentions are preserved through implementation, thus enhancing overall project efficiency and consistency.

Testing and Feedback Mechanisms

To achieve seamless user experiences across multiple devices, testing and feedback mechanisms play a pivotal role. By implementing structured testing approaches, you can identify inconsistencies and areas for enhancement early in the design process, ultimately refining the interface to meet user needs and preferences.

Cross-Device Testing Strategies

Implement cross-device testing strategies by utilizing a combination of real device testing and emulator tools. Focus on key scenarios for various screen sizes and orientations, ensuring that layouts adapt gracefully and functionality remains intact. Tools like BrowserStack and Sauce Labs enable you to test across numerous devices simultaneously, enhancing your testing efficiency.

Gathering User Feedback

Gathering user feedback involves utilizing surveys, usability testing sessions, and analytics tools to gain insights into user interactions across devices. Incorporate feedback loops into your design process, capturing qualitative and quantitative data to inform iterative improvements.

Surveys provide direct insight into user satisfaction, while usability sessions can reveal friction points that may not be immediately apparent. Analytics tools like Google Analytics and Hotjar allow you to track user behavior, pinpointing where users encounter difficulties. Combining qualitative insights from user feedback with quantitative data creates a comprehensive understanding of your product’s performance across platforms, empowering you to make informed design decisions that enhance consistency and usability.

Future Trends in Cross-Platform Design

As digital experiences evolve, cross-platform design will increasingly prioritize user-centric approaches. You’ll see a shift towards designs that not only accommodate various devices but also learn from user interactions and adapt accordingly. The integration of AI and machine learning will enable more personalized interfaces that anticipate user needs, thereby enhancing engagement and satisfaction.

Adaptive vs. Responsive Design

Adaptive design delivers different layouts based on predefined screen sizes, optimizing for specific devices, while responsive design fluidly adjusts to any screen size, creating a seamless experience across all platforms. Your choice between them often depends on project requirements and user demographics, with responsive designs generally offering more flexibility.

Emerging Technologies and Their Impact

Technologies such as augmented reality (AR), virtual reality (VR), and new web standards like CSS Grid are reshaping cross-platform design. You can leverage AR for interactive experiences, bringing static designs to life, while CSS Grid offers a sophisticated layout system that meets the demands of varied screen sizes efficiently.

For instance, AR applications, like IKEA Place, allow users to visualize furniture in their spaces, bridging the gap between digital and physical environments. Innovations in frameworks like React Native enable you to create applications that perform consistently across platforms, optimizing both functionality and user experience. As these technologies mature, they challenge traditional design approaches, demanding you to stay ahead of the curve to meet evolving user expectations.

To wrap up

Taking this into account, ensuring consistency across different devices requires a thoughtful design strategy that prioritizes user experience. You should recognize the unique characteristics of each platform while maintaining a unified brand identity. By implementing responsive design and testing across multiple devices, you can enhance accessibility and user satisfaction. Your goal should be to create seamless interactions that empower users, regardless of the device they choose, ultimately leading to better engagement and retention.

Similar Posts